The Chase
Two determined men - one dressed in uniform blue, the other a man whose guilt seemed evident based on his flight from the scene. Legs pounded the pavement keeping time to a merciless rhythm...
The overpowering sound of heartbeats flooded through Jim Reed's entire body and echoed through his temple. Lungs worked overtime and muscles strained to keep up the demand for more speed.
The original call had been a 405 radio... When Unit 1-Adam-12 arrived at the location, a wiry man about 20 years old had burst out the front door and run down the street. Jim immediately leapt from the car and gave chase. Malloy followed in their black and white. The suspect showed absolutely no signs of tiring. Suddenly the man turned a corner. Jim Reed slid to a stop and peered around the edge of the building carefully.
Nothing.
A dead end?
The road had led to a brick retaining wall, which Jim estimated to be at least 12 feet high. The building by which it stood had no door and no window. A parade of ancient beer bottles marched along the ground in disorderly ranks. Discarded newspapers shuffled nervously in the light breeze.
"No one vanishes into thin air," was Jim's thought as he breathed heavily. He glanced back where they had come from... no sign of Pete. Reed had followed the suspect through several really tight alleys through which the patrol car would not pass. His partner had probably tried to get in front of them using another street.
Jim walked further into the area, in case an exit was somehow concealed. There was just no way to scale the wall and there didn't appear to be a way out. He turned to leave, disappointed that he had not been fast enough to stop the vanishing act.
"Hey Pig!" A voice rang out from behind him.
Jim spun around in time to see a man standing on top of the wall. There was a mere second between the time that he heard the voice, turned, and the shot rang out. As he fell, he caught a glimpse of a sneering face and realized that this was not the man he had been chasing. Pain seared through his shoulder and the world disappeared into blackness.
